Radio Free Asia tests DRM to China

 

@MohanNataraja16 on Twitter (X) received Radio Free Asia (RFA) DRM test broadcast in Mandarin on 11700 khz in London, UK on June 11, 2024 at 2100 UTC.

No further information is known about the test and it is unknown from where it was broadcast. RFA is operated by the US government and "...provide(s) independent, uncensored and accurate local news to a weekly audience of nearly 60 million who lack access to a free press or live in media environments vulnerable to authoritarian disinformation."

@atake on Twitter (X) has also confirmed this broadcast received in Nagoya, Japan.


Based on KiwiSDR reception, it is likely originating from Kuwait. Before sign-on Arabic music was being played as well.

@alokeshgupta says RFA DRM tests towards China are scheduled from 11 to 16 June 2024 at 2100-2200 UTC on 11700 kHz. Reception reports to qsl@rfa.org

Brazilian public broadcaster (EBC) plans SW DRM trial

Here is great news from DRM supporter Rafael Diniz:
"Good news, EBC (the Brazilian public broadcaster)
detailed their plans for the SW trial. They'll use
a Continental Lensa tx at power levels of 4kW, 1kW
and 250W with the antenna at Brasilia beamed to 
Amazonia (beamed to the north). They made reception
prediction using Voacap and the expected coverage
with be the centre and part of the north of Brazil
at 4kW. They'll start testing the tx in AM mode in
a few days at 6000kHz. Also, as soon as possible,
they'll change the tx crystal to 5990kHz (EBC's
Radio Senado frequency) and install the DRM30 exciter."

DRM tests from TWR and PCJ



Both of these are long-shots but might be fun to try and DX...

Trans World Radio is running a test on 11825 kHz
(300 kW) from Yerevan at 1330-1530 UTC on Saturday 28th Sept.

PCJ will run a test on October 13, 2013 on 15645khz targeting South East Asia/East Asia.
